For example, the small angle approximation is briefly mentioned, which is where for very small angles, the value of sine and tangent are approximately equal to the angle itself. Similarly, for cosine, we use a truncated version of its Taylor series in the small angle approximation.

This approximation is immensely helpful in approximating solutions to difficult systems in physics. For example, a differential equation showing how pendulums behave, even in a very basic system, contains a sine term that makes the equation difficult to solve. However with the small angle approximation, the equation becomes very similar to the simple harmonic motion equation, which we do know how to solve.

So although approximations don't give us exact answers, they are extremely useful in solving problems we wouldn't otherwise know how to tackle.
